#58fbac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#58fbac is composed of 34.5% red, 98.4% green and 67.5%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 64.9% cyan, 0% magenta, 31.5% yellow and 1.6% black. It has a hue angle of 150.9 degrees, a saturation of 95.3% and a lightness of 66.5%. #58fbac color hex could be obtained by blending #b0ffff with #00f759. Closest websafe color is: #66ff99.

#58fbac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#58fbac has RGB values of R:88, G:251, B:172 and CMYK values of C:0.65, M:0, Y:0.31, K:0.02. Its decimal value is 5831596.
